Abstract

The utility model relates to the field of a valve and particularly relates to a constant-pressure quantitative titration device. The constant-pressure quantitative titration device comprises a liquid storage tank, a floating ball, a transfusion hose and a titration connector part, wherein a liquid inlet and an air outlet are formed in the top of the liquid storage tank; a liquid outlet is formed in the bottom of the liquid storage tank; the floating ball, the transfusion hose and the titration connector part are arranged inside the liquid storage tank; the floating ball is provided with a liquid inlet and a liquid outlet; the liquid outlet of the floating ball is connected with one end of the transfusion hose; the titration connector part is provided with a liquid inlet and a liquid outlet; the other end of the transfusion hose is connected with the liquid inlet of the titration connector part; and the liquid outlet of the titration connector part is connected with the liquid outlet formed in the bottom of the liquid storage tank. With the adoption of the device disclosed by the utility model, a solution can be output by a constant flow.

Background technology
At chemical field, often need to be with different solution according to constant flow configuration mixed solution.In layoutprocedure, a liquid reserve tank fills a kind of solution, and a liquid reserve tank fills another kind of solution, and two kinds of solution flow out with certain flow from liquid reserve tank respectively, mix in other liquid reserve tank.According to the ratio of various solution in the mixed solution, determine the flow of solution in the various liquid reserve tanks.So that the proportions constant of various solution in the mixed solution.
Along with solution flows out from the liquid reserve tank middle outlet, liquid level in the liquid reserve tank constantly reduces, the pressure at liquid reserve tank inner outlet place is constantly reduced, cause the flow of the solution that flows out from liquid reserve tank to reduce gradually, can't guarantee amount of infusion, thereby affect the ratio of various different solutions in the mixed solution, and then affect the result of use of mixed solution.

Embodiment
Be illustrated in figure 1 as the described constant pressure quantitative titration outfit of present embodiment, this constant pressure quantitative titration outfit comprises liquid reserve tank 101, ball float 105, infusion tube 106, titration valve interface part 107.
The top of described liquid reserve tank 101 is provided with inlet 104 and air inlet 102, and the bottom of described liquid reserve tank 101 is provided with liquid outlet.
Described ball float 105, infusion tube 106 and titration valve interface part 107 are arranged on the inside of described liquid reserve tank 101.
Described ball float 105 is provided with inlet 103 and liquid outlet, and the liquid outlet of described ball float 105 is connected with an end of described infusion tube 106.
Described titration valve interface part 107 is provided with inlet and liquid outlet, and the other end of described infusion tube 106 is connected with the inlet of described titration valve interface part 107.
The liquid outlet of described titration valve interface part 107 is connected with the liquid outlet that described liquid reserve tank 101 bottoms arrange.
Because the inside of constant voltage titration outfit is provided with ball float 105, this ball float 105 can swim on the liquid level in the liquid reserve tank 101, along with the solution in the liquid reserve tank 101 flows out, liquid level constantly descends, but the degree of depth of inlet 103 relative liquid surfaces of ball float 105 is always constant, so that the pressure at inlet 103 places of ball float 105 is constant, thereby can guarantee that solution is constant at the course pressure that flows out liquid reserve tank 101, and then can make solution with constant flow output.
Further, also comprise titration valve master switch 108, titration valve quantitative switching 109, observation cover 110.
Described titration valve master switch 108, titration valve quantitative switching 109, observation cover 110 are linked in sequence successively.
The liquid outlet of described liquid reserve tank 101 bottoms is connected with described titration valve master switch 108.
After flowing out from titration valve interface part 107, solution can flow out through titration valve master switch 108, titration valve quantitative switching 109, observation cover 110 successively.Described titration valve master switch 108 can be controlled the opening and closing of described constant pressure quantitative titration outfit.Described titration valve quantitative switching 109 can be controlled the flow of titration.The size that described observation cover 110 is used for observing liquid inventory.When the flow of solution is excessive, can regulate described titration valve quantitative switching 109, flow is reduced.When the flow of solution is too small, can regulate described titration valve quantitative switching 109, flow is increased.
Before the constant pressure quantitative titration outfit was not worked, the liquid level of liquid reserve tank 101 remained static, and ball float 105 swims on the liquid level.After the constant pressure quantitative titration outfit was started working, the solution in the liquid reserve tank 101 entered infusion tube from the inlet 103 of ball float 105, and solution flows out through titration valve interface part 107.Liquid level in the liquid reserve tank 101 descends, ball float 105 descends thereupon, because the inlet 103 of ball float 105 remains unchanged with the distance of liquid level always, namely the pressure at inlet 103 places of ball float 105 is constant, thereby titer is accurately constant after guaranteeing the each unlatching of constant pressure quantitative titration outfit.
